TERRE HAUTE, Ind. (WTWO/WAWV) – An SUV hit a funeral home Tuesday night. A woman faces charges.

The Terre Haute Police Department said it responded to the Samaritan Affordable Funeral Home & Cremations at 2425 Wabash Avenue after receiving a report of a vehicle striking the building.
According to Lt. Justin Sears, officers located the vehicle’s two occupants. The driver was identified as Ashley L. Mundell, 37, of Terre Haute. There was also a 13-year-old juvenile passenger.
Police said Mundell was operating the vehicle while intoxicated.
She was placed under arrest and charged with Operating a Vehicle While Intoxicated with a Passenger Less Than 18 Years of Age, a felony. She was transported to the Vigo County Jail.
Both Mundell and the juvenile were treated for minor injuries.
